Experience the Best of Rajasthan in 5 Days

  1. Day 1: Jaipur - The Pink City
    Flight arrival at 8:00 am
    Distance from Jaipur International Airport: 13.2 km (30 minutes)

    Start your morning with a visit to the famous Amber Fort located on a hilltop, which will give you a breathtaking view of the city. Afternoon, head to the City Palace - a magnificent palace complex filled with courtyards, gardens and museums. In the evening, visit Hawa Mahal, the iconic palace of winds and enjoy local street food at the bustling Johari Bazaar.

  2. Day 2: Jodhpur - The Blue City
    Distance from Jaipur: 338 km (5 hours)

    Start your day by visiting the majestic Mehrangarh Fort, one of the largest forts in India. Afternoon, head to the Jaswant Thada, a white marble mausoleum built in memory of Maharaja Jaswant Singh II. In the evening, stroll along the vibrant streets of the old town and explore the local markets.

  3. Day 3: Udaipur - The City of Lakes
    Distance from Jodhpur: 259 km (4.5 hours)

    Begin your day by visiting the City Palace, a beautiful palace complex located on the shores of Lake Pichola. Afternoon, enjoy a boat ride on the serene lake and visit Jag Mandir Palace, located on an island in the middle of the lake. In the evening, witness the sound and light show at the City Palace.

  4. Day 4: Pushkar - The Holy City
    Distance from Udaipur: 288 km (5 hours)

    Spend your morning visiting the famous Brahma Temple, one of the few temples dedicated to Lord Brahma. Afternoon, take a dip in the holy Pushkar Lake and explore the vibrant market streets. In the evening, witness the aarti ceremony at the sacred lake.

  5. Day 5: Jaisalmer - The Golden City
    Distance from Pushkar: 480 km (8 hours)

    Begin your day by visiting the Jaisalmer Fort, a magnificent fort made of yellow sandstone. Afternoon, visit the Patwon Ki Haveli, a beautiful mansion with intricate carvings and murals. In the evening, enjoy a camel ride in the Thar Desert and witness the mesmerizing sunset at the Sam Sand Dunes.

Recommendations

If you have more time, consider visiting the Ranthambore National Park, famous for its tigers and other wildlife. You can also take a side trip to the nearby city of Ajmer, known for its famous Dargah Sharif. To make the most of your trip, consider hiring a local guide who can provide you with in-depth knowledge of the history and culture of Rajasthan.
